How To Edit SRT Files With An SRT Editor

Subtitles are common in our daily lives, especially in some movies and videos, to provide us with better viewing effects. When you make such videos, there will be a need to edit subtitles like the SRT file. Thus, choosing an effective subtitle editor is helpful. The three best subtitle editors are introduced here, which can be used on Windows, Mac, and Online. With these functional tools, you can change the time duration, etc. Also, some of them are subtitle creators that can insert the new subtitle file, with desired settings. Keep on reading to know how to edit SRT files with them easily. Part 1. How to Edit SRT File on Windows Part 2. How to Edit SRT File on Mac Part 3. How to Edit SRT File Online Bonus Tips: How to Create SRT File on Windows 10How to Edit SRT File on WindowsWithout installation on PC, you can edit this subtitle file with an efficient tool. Notepad is the pre-installed Windows tool that helps edit SRT files easily. The only difficulty is how to find the tool and apply the right method to edit the subtitles. To use Notepad, right click the SRT file and select the Open With option. Then, choose Notepad to open it.Notepad is an easy-to-use tool to help record something quickly. It is common to view the file on Windows PC. Editing SRT is one of its useful functions. For more details, you can follow the below guide. Here is a list of steps on how to edit the SRT file on Windows, using Notepad:Step 1. Select the SRT file and right click it. Choose "Open with" and find Notepad. And text are included in this file. Then, edit them as you like. At the same time, you cannot change the file extension as the format should be SRT by default.Step 3. After editing, hold down and press Ctrl + S on the keyboard to save the edited SRT file. How to Edit SRT File on MacAs one of the best media players on Mac, VLC media player allows editing subtitles easily. It's effective to sync subtitles with this functional tool. Meanwhile, you are allowed to adjust the subtitle delay by holding down H on the keyboard. When the subtitle is behind audio, you are supposed to press H. Otherwise, hold down J. Apart from editing subtitles, the VLC media player is known for converting media files. You can convert your audio and video files to different formats. Also, it's easy when playing the media file on it. Edit the SRT file, using VLC media player:Step 1. Import the video file into the VLC media player. Then, from the toolbar, click "Subtitles" > "Subtitle track". Make sure the subtitles are turned on.Step 2. Then, hit "Window" > "Track Synchronization". You can correct the alignment easily. Use "Subtitles/Video" to apply features like adjusting its speed and duration factor. Step 3. After adjusting subtitles, go back to the video and view the edited subtitles. Note: The steps between the Mac and Windows version is different, while you can achieve the same effect. How to Edit SRT File OnlineTo avoid the hassle of installing software on the desktop, try the online subtitles editors like Kapwing. Its Add Caption tool is specialized in creating and editing subtitles for video. It's accessible to add the SRT subtitle with this online service, by clicking "+ Add subtitle".
